In 1935, Indiana Jones is tasked by Indian villagers with reclaiming a rock stolen from them by a secret cult beneath the catacombs of an ancient palace. Alongside his companions, Willie and Short Round, Indy embarks on a dangerous journey to Pankot Palace, where they discover the cult's sinister rituals and enslaved children. With the power of five united stones at stake, Indy must thwart the cult's plans and rescue the hostages. In a final battle, Indiana invokes the name of Shiva and defeats the cult leader, Mola Ram, saving the day and returning the sacred stone to the villagers.

Alice stumbles into the world of Wonderland when she follows a White Rabbit down a rabbit hole. She encounters many strange creatures and experiences bizarre events, such as growing and shrinking in size. Throughout her journey, she meets talking animals, gets involved in a caucus-race, interacts with a garden of talking flowers, receives guidance from the Cheshire Cat, attends a mad tea party, plays croquet with the Queen of Hearts, and ultimately finds herself facing her own execution. In the end, she realizes that it was all just a dream and wakes up to her sister's voice.
